The Giants have experience in these games, but the Royals have the momentum after their huge win in Game 6 and they also won the last matchup with these pitchers. The Giants had Madison Bumgarner pitch a shutout in Game 5 to give the team a 3-2 lead and now things are all tied up at 3-3 after the 10-0 loss on Tuesday night. The Giants usually don't allow things to carry over, but with it being Game 7 the pressure is on and they need Hudson to pitch as he is capable of.

The Royals shook up the Giants early with seven runs and now the Giants will try and do the same in this game and this will be an intense matchup. Home teams have won Game 7 over the last stretch of championships and the last nine have won those and it hasn't happened for an away team in quite a while. The Giants have won two titles in five years and now they are looking for number three and they have a very tough team against them.

The Royals have been here before, just not this group of players, as KC was down 3-2 in their series with the Cardinals 29 years ago and ended up winning the final two games at home. It will be all hands on deck for the teams and that means ace James Shields or Madison Bumgarner could enter the game at some point. Hudson and Guthrie likely will be on short leashes for their managers and that could be very interesting to see how they handle it.

The Giants had Bumgarner as their best pitcher this season and there is a good chance he comes in, as he now has a 4-0 record with a .29 ERA in his World Series career. This season he had a sub 3.00 ERA and he also had 18 wins to lead the team and he also had over 200 strikeouts this season. Bumgarner was brilliant in Game 5 and now the Giants have to fight some history to win Game seven and this should be as intense a matchup as baseball has seen in a while.

Hudson comes in as the oldest Game 7 seven starter in the history of baseball and this has been his first taste of the World Series and he would love to win it for the Giants. The team has to play in a tough stadium in Kansas City that surely will be rocking hard and after the game on Tuesday, the Giants have to find a way to put that behind them. The team was blasted early and did not come back and now they are hoping to do the same in this matchup, but based on the past, this is KC's game to lose for the matchup in a winner take all game.
